These guys don’t get enough love. There aren’t too many places in Durango where you can get two entrees for $25 or less anymore. I always get the taco salad because they actually fill it with a good amount of fresh shredded chicken breast. Nothing is ever over salted and there’s a little salsa bar with rajas, limes and sliced cucumber to go with your meal. The cooking staff always have their hair tied back, gloves and aprons on. It’s always clean. Often I get Mexican food and my stomach will be upset within the hour from too much oil or spice. Not so here. My partner is Mexican and really liked the fajita burrito because its actually filled with steak and veggies,m and not filler like rice and beans. Weekends the offer a traditional tripe soup.
